Refacing vs. Replacing Cabinets

Refacing cabinets is a cheaper option than replacing them all. It means you keep the old cabinets but make them look new with new veneer and new doors and drawer fronts. Studies show refacing can save you a lot of money compared to buying new cabinets.

  • Typical refacing costs: Fraction of full replacement price
  • Average savings: Up to 50% compared to new cabinet installation
  • Completion time: Faster than complete cabinet replacement

Stylish Hardware Choices

Changing your cabinet hardware is a quick and easy way to update your kitchen. New finishes like brushed nickel, matte black, or brass can make your kitchen look modern and stylish without spending a lot.

  1. Hardware cost: $2-$10 per piece
  2. Average installation: $50-$100 for standard kitchen
  3. Potential visual impact: Dramatic kitchen transformation

If you like DIY projects, you can update your cabinet hardware in a weekend for under $100. This is a great option for those who want to save money but still want a stylish kitchen.

Laminate: An Affordable Design Solution

Laminate countertops are a great choice for those on a budget. They cost between $8-$20 per square foot. These surfaces are versatile and can look like expensive materials like granite and marble.

  • Cost-effective material (starting at $25 per square foot)
  • Wide range of design options
  • Easy installation and maintenance
  • Quick cleaning and durability

Creative Butcher Block Applications

Butcher block countertops add warmth and character to kitchens. They cost between $30-$85 per square foot. Use them for kitchen islands or accent areas to add natural texture and keep costs down.

  1. Ideal for farmhouse and rustic kitchen styles
  2. Potential DIY installation to reduce labor expenses
  3. Available in multiple wood types: maple, oak, cherry
  4. Can be combined with other countertop materials

Vinyl Plank: An Affordable Flooring Solution

Vinyl plank flooring is great for those watching their budget. It costs between $2 and $5 per square foot. This is much cheaper than hardwood, which can be up to $10 per square foot. Vinyl planks are:

  • Water-resistant (up to 60% of options)
  • Easy to install yourself
  • Available in many styles
  • Long-lasting for busy kitchens
